About the unit This unit is a level 2 trauma center with 20 operating rooms in our Area D tower and 6 procedure rooms in our Area A suite. Approximately 45% of our cases are comprised of total joints and ortho cases. The remaining 55% of cases are comprised of General, Colon/Rectal, Urology, Bariatric, Plastic, Spine, Vascular and ENT surgeries. Troy Central Processing is a direct supporting unit for surgery. Daily, CPD produces anywhere from 450-750 instrument trays, we service the operating rooms and all the supporting ancillary units within the hospital that require the use of sterile equipment. We have two types of sterilization processes on site, high temperature steam and low temperature hydrogen peroxide and utilize state of the art equipment to ensure that our patients are provided clean, sterile instrumentation for each surgical procedure in house. Central processing is a team environment, as technicians, coordinators and central processing support staff work together to ensure that our patients, OR team and the surgeons have everything they need to have a successful surgery. Scope of work Responsible for inspecting, disinfecting, assembling, processing and distributing patient care instruments, equipment and supplies in accordance with established policies, procedures and Association of Advancement of Medical Instrumentation (AAMI) standards. Acts as a role model and resource to peers and other members of the health care team related to processing of equipment, instruments, and supplies. Stores, rotates and ensures all instruments and supplies are correctly labeled. π οΈ Instrument Processing & Sterilization Cleans and inspects soiled instruments using proper PPE. Tests equipment with tools like insulation and leak testers to ensure sterilization. Assembles instruments per established standards and IFUs. β
Quality & Accuracy Strives for zero defects through thorough inspections. Maintains a low error rate and high productivity. π₯ Team Support & Communication Serves as a role model and resource for peers. Responds to phone requests and departmental issues professionally. π¦ Workflow & Prioritization Prioritizes processing based on surgical schedules and physician needs. Handles vendor trays and complex instrumentation efficiently. π§ Technical Proficiency Differentiates instrument functionality and specialties. Monitors sterilization equipment and submits repair requests as needed. Expertly assembles high-complexity trays like implants and ambulatory kits. π€ Customer Service Ensures timely, professional handling of all customer area requests.
